> Recently, I use the command otbcli_TrainVectorClassifier with the model of 
> Shark Random Forest to training a RF model for classification. The training 
> data is a 15GB sqlite file. The command is as following:
>
> otbcli_TrainVectorClassifier -io.vd input.sqlite -io.out output_model.txt  
> -feat band_field -cfield lc_id -classifier sharkrf 
> -classifier.sharkrf.nbtrees 100 -classifier.sharkrf.nodesize 1 
> -classifier.sharkrf.mtry 0 -classifier.sharkrf.oobr 1 -progress 1
>
> When I launched the command, I found a issue is that it seems the training 
> process only uses one core of my computer.
>
> The environment of my computer is :
>
> Screen Shot 2019-02-05 at 12.26.45 pm.jpg
>
> So, my question is: Is it possible to make use of all 12 cores of my computer 
> when training with otbcli_TrainVectorClassifier?
